What are some common challenges CNC Grind operators face during their shifts, and how can they overcome them?

CNC Grind operators often encounter challenges such as maintaining tight tolerances, troubleshooting machine errors, and minimizing downtime due to tool wear. To overcome these, operators need to closely monitor machine performance, perform regular maintenance, and proactively replace grinding tools. Additionally, effective communication with quality control and maintenance teams helps quickly resolve issues and maintain production flow. Staying updated with the latest CNC grinding technologies and best practices can further enhance problem-solving skills in this role.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a CNC Grinder, and why are they important?

To thrive as a CNC Grinder, you typically need a strong understanding of machining principles, blueprint reading, and mechanical aptitude, often supported by a high school diploma or technical training in CNC operations. Experience with CNC grinding machines, familiarity with CAD/CAM software, and knowledge of measurement tools like micrometers and gauges are essential. Attention to detail, problem-solving skills, and the ability to work independently are vital soft skills in this role. These competencies are crucial for producing high-precision components efficiently and maintaining quality standards in a manufacturing environment.

What are CNC Grinders?

CNC Grinders are specialized machines that use computer numerical control (CNC) technology to automate the grinding process of materials, usually metal or hard plastics. These machines are operated by CNC Grinding Technicians or Operators, who program and monitor the equipment to ensure precision and efficiency in creating parts or tools. CNC grinding is commonly used in manufacturing industries to produce high-quality components with tight tolerances. The role typically involves interpreting blueprints, setting up machines, and performing maintenance checks. CNC Grinders help improve productivity and consistency in manufacturing by reducing manual labor and human error.
